Ana García Arcicollar Vallejo
Ana García Arcicollar Vallejo

GARCíA ARCICOLLAR VALLEJO Ana

Country: Spain
Sport: Swimming
Class: B2-S12

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Ana began her swimming career at age 10. Three years later, she won three bronze medals at the Atlanta Paralympic Games in 1996 at only 13 years of age. After winning silver and bronze at the Sydney Paralympic Games in 2000 she also achieved a number of world records in both long and short course. Throughout 2003-2004 Ana has been in top form, achieving several top rankings in World Championships leading up to ATHENS 2004. When she is not in the pool, Ana is a full time student training to be a primary school teacher in Special Education.
